About the SAATLY

The SAATLY (IMO: 6417308) is a bulk carrier built in 2022 currently sailing under the flag of Liberia. The vessel has an estimated length overall (LOA) of 199.9 meters and a beam of 32.2 meters, alongside a deadweight tonnage of 61,217 DWT.

Operating under the service status of IN SERVICE/COMMISSION, the vessel relies on the ABS for its classification society standards. Technical and commercial management is publicly recorded to be overseen by AZERBAIJAN STATE CASPIAN.
